主機測評&技術分享将通過本文講解一步一步帶你摸清楚一個網站從0到1的全過程,從以下幾個步驟展開:
域名——備案
伺服器———域名綁定(DNS解析)——Web容器(如:Nginx)
網站内容——靜态檔案 (如:dede網站檔案)
翻譯過來就是你把你的東西放在哪裡?别人通過什麼方式可以找到!

網站建設
就是網絡位址,通常我們簡稱“網址”
這個網絡位址就叫網站域名。比如說當我們輸入百度的網站域名,就能正确通路到百度的網站了。域名是解析到IP上來通路,有了域名,我們就不用輸入IP來通路某個網站,這樣友善記憶。
如何申請網站域名?百度雲、阿裡雲、騰訊雲皆可,主機測評&技術分享以百度雲注冊申請域名為例:
域名注冊
域名的注冊遵循先申請先注冊為原則,當你要注冊的域名,必須得先查詢一下是否被注冊,注冊過的,就不允許再次注冊了。這個申請域名的比較簡單,自己去操作一下,就會了!
國家要求國内任何一個網站必須進行工信部ICP備案,如果沒有備案,你的網站連結是無法通路的。
網站備案的目的就是為了防止在網上從事非法的網站經營活動,打擊不良網際網路資訊的傳播,如果網站不備案的話,很有可能被查處以後關停。
目前阿裡雲是可以直接通過手機用戶端直接去申請備案的,而且速度會比網站備案快很多,建議直接用手機用戶端去備案。
【當然,覺得國内伺服器備案比較麻煩,可以選擇香港伺服器,香港伺服器是免備案的,緻臻資料可以為您提供香港免備案雲伺服器,但是記得域名實名認證使用,比較友善些!】
伺服器這裡推薦緻臻資料,因為确實比較優惠,服務也好!
同時現在注冊就有9折優惠可以享受,重點是可以免備案,友善快捷!
緻臻資料雲伺服器
在緻臻資料的網站(zhizhenyun.com.cn),注冊送出工單,即可享受所有伺服器9折優惠!
到這裡我們已經得到了網站域名和伺服器,但是他們都是分别獨立的,我們需要将域名和網站主機關聯起來:
域名解析
添加一條記錄,将我們的伺服器的公網IP填到記錄值的位置:
這裡我們以Nginx為例,Nginx是一個免費的、開源的、高性能的 HTTP 和反向代理服務,假設你的伺服器為centos系統
安裝
sudo yum install nginx
使用 yum 進行 Nginx 安裝時,Nginx 配置檔案在 /etc/nginx 目錄下
常用的nginx指令
驗證 Nginx 是否成功啟動,可以在浏覽器中打開輸入你的ip,您将看到預設的 Nginx 歡迎頁面,類似于下圖所示:
Nginx安裝
到了這一步,我們有了域名,伺服器,web容器,就差往容器裡面塞東西了,以 Vue 為例,我們首先要拿到 Vue 項目 build 後的dist檔案夾
以最原始的方法将dist上傳到服務包
注意這裡我們是上傳的 zip 檔案,到了伺服器你需要将目标 zip 解壓
最後我們配置一下nginx
配置完重新開機一下nginx
不出意外,這個時候在浏覽器輸入你的域名應該能看到你的網站啦!
關于伺服器建站過程就講完了,有任何的問題,都可以私信